Charles Henry Alston (November 28, 1907 - April 27, 1977) was an American painter, sculptor, illustrator, muralist and teacher who lived and worked in the New York City neighborhood of Harlem. In dancers, the rhythm of the music is expressed through the tilt of the figures' heads, the bend of their backs and knees, and the lightness of their feet. In 1910, when Charles was three, his father died suddenly of a cerebral hemorrhage. In the beginning, Charles Alston's mural work was inspired by the work of Aaron Douglas, Diego Rivera, and José Clemente Orozco, the latter who he met when they did mural work in New York. Alston was active in the Harlem Renaissance; Alston was the first African-American supervisor for the Works Progress Administration's Federal Art Project. Dancers combines primitive and African influences with bright colors and a fascinating surface to convey the loose movements of a jazz dance. Charles Henry Alston was born on November 28, 1907, in Charlotte, North Carolina to Reverend Primus Priss Alston and Anna Elizabeth (Miller) Alston and the youngest of five children.
